前端常用函数

前端开发主要涉及JavaScript函数,包括字符串处理、数组操作、DOM操作等核心功能

‌字符串处理函数‌

trim() - 删除字符串两端的空格或预定义字符

str_pad() - 把字符串填充为指定长度

strtolower() - 将字符串转为小写

substring() - 提取字符串的子串

split() - 将字符串分割为数组

‌数组操作函数‌

push()/pop() - 数组末尾添加/删除元素

shift()/unshift() - 数组开头删除/添加元素

map() - 对数组每个元素执行函数

filter() - 过滤数组元素

reduce() - 将数组元素计算为单个值

‌数学计算函数‌

Math.random() - 生成随机数

Math.max()/Math.min() - 求最大值/最小值

Math.round() - 四舍五入浮点数

PHP常用函数

PHP提供了丰富的内置函数,涵盖字符串、数组、数据库等多个方面

‌字符串处理函数‌

addslashes() - 在预定义字符前添加反斜杠

explode() - 把字符串打散为数组

chr() - 从指定ASCII值返回字符

chunk_split() - 把字符串分割为更小部分

‌数组操作函数‌

count() - 计算数组元素个数

array_push() - 向数组尾部添加一个或多个元素

array_pop() - 删除数组最后一个元素

array_merge() - 合并数组

‌MySQL数据库函数‌

mysql_connect() - 建立数据库连接

mysql_select_db() - 选择数据库

mysql_query() - 执行SQL查询

mysql_fetch_array() - 从结果集中取得一行作为关联数组

MySQL常用语句

MySQL语句主要用于数据库的增删改查操作

‌数据查询语句‌

SELECT * FROM table_name - 查询表中所有数据

SELECT column1, column2 FROM table - 查询指定列

WHERE 条件筛选

ORDER BY 排序

LIMIT 限制结果数量

‌数据操作语句‌

INSERT INTO table (col1, col2) VALUES (val1, val2) - 插入数据

UPDATE table SET col1=val1 WHERE condition - 更新数据

DELETE FROM table WHERE condition - 删除数据

‌数据库管理语句‌

CREATE DATABASE dbname - 创建数据库

DROP DATABASE dbname - 删除数据库

CREATE TABLE 和 DROP TABLE - 创建和删除数据表

这些函数和语句构成了Web开发的基础工具集,熟练掌握它们能够显著提高开发效率

在实际项目中,这些技术通常需要协同工作,前端负责用户交互,PHP处理业务逻辑,MySQL负责数据存储

标签:

相关文章

享受工作:找到事业与生活的平衡点

工作是我们日常生活中不可或缺的一部分。我们花费大量的时间和精力在工作中,因此,如何享受工作并找到事业与生活的平衡点就显得尤为重要。在这篇文章中,我们将探讨如何享受工作,让事业和生活愉快并行。首先,了解...

黄金秋季

黄金秋季,这是一个充满色彩和韵味的季节。天空湛蓝,阳光明媚,微风轻拂,树叶由绿变黄,由黄变红,最终落叶归根。这是一个大自然最美丽的时刻,一切都在这一刻达到了高潮。秋天的阳光特别柔和,它不像夏天那样灼热...

更创新的挣钱方式

在探讨更创新的利用网站挣钱的方式时,我们可以结合当前的技术趋势和市场需求,挖掘一些具有前瞻性和独特性的策略。以下是一些建议:一、基于大数据与人工智能的个性化服务智能推荐系统:利用大数据和人工智能技术,...

前端开发中数组

前端开发中,数组是最基础且强大的数据结构之一。JavaScript提供了丰富的数组操作方法,可以满足各种开发需求。下面我将从基础操作、高阶函数、动态渲染、过滤搜索和表单处理五个方面,为您详细介绍前端数...

前端状态管理器

前端状态管理器是用于管理应用数据状态的核心工具,主要解决组件间状态共享、数据一致性等问题。以下是主流方案和技术要点:一、核心概念‌状态类型‌本地状态(组件内部)全局状态(跨组件共享)服务端状态(异步数...

前端-弹性布局

弹性布局(Flexbox)是CSS3中用于实现高效页面布局的模块化方案,通过弹性容器(Flex Container)和弹性项目(Flex Item)的交互,实现灵活的空间分配与对齐控制。其核心特性如下...